The EF Legacy: Makefield Technology Meets the Classic Blade

March 12, 2026Updated:March 13, 2026No Comments3 Mins Read
Facebook Twitter Pinterest LinkedIn Tumblr WhatsApp Email
Share
Facebook Twitter LinkedIn WhatsApp Pinterest Email

Bensalem, PA –  For years, the Makefield Putters name has been synonymous with high-stability mallets and game-changing MOI. But at Makefield, we listen to our players. You asked for our advanced, tour-proven technology in a traditional shape.

We delivered. Introducing the EF Legacy.

The EF Legacy is more than just a new model; it is the culmination of American ingenuity and elite engineering. It’s designed for the purist who loves the look of a blade but refuses to sacrifice the forgiveness and roll consistency of a modern mallet.

100% Made in America

While many in the golf industry have moved production overseas, Makefield remains committed to our roots. Every EF Legacy putter is 100% CNC-milled and assembled right here in Bensalem, Pennsylvania.

Starting as a solid billet of 6061-T6 Aircraft Grade Aluminum, our putters are crafted with a level of precision that casting simply cannot match. By keeping our manufacturing in-house, we ensure that every head, shaft, and weight port meets our rigorous standards before it ever reaches your bag.

The Tech Inside the Blade

Don’t let the classic silhouette fool you—the EF Legacy is packed with the same “Path of Inertia” technology that put Makefield on the map.

  1. The X-3 Weight System

The EF Legacy features our proprietary X-3 Weight System, allowing for “Player Torque Matching.” Most blades have a fixed weight and a specific “toe hang” that forces you to change your stroke. With the X-3 system, you can adjust the internal weights (Aluminum, Stainless Steel, or Tungsten) to match your natural path.

  • Heel Weighted: Helps players who tend to miss right.
  • Toe Weighted: Perfect for players who miss left.
  • Balanced: Provides maximum stability through the hitting zone.
  1. Radial Cusp Face Technology (RCFT)

Our patented Radial Cusp Face is the secret to the best roll in golf. Through precise milling, we’ve created “intersectional nexuses” that minimize ball-to-face friction. This results in the lowest skid-to-roll numbers in the industry, meaning your ball gets into a true forward roll faster and stays on its intended line.

  1. Customizable Hosel Selections

Every golfer has a unique eye for alignment. The EF Legacy is available in three distinct hosel configurations to suit your visual preference and stroke type:

  • Double Bend
  • Plumber’s Neck
  • Slant Neck

Why Switch to the EF Legacy?

The transition from a mallet to a blade usually comes with a “forgiveness penalty.” We’ve engineered the EF Legacy to eliminate that trade-off. By utilizing high-density weights in a slim profile, we’ve achieved a high Moment of Inertia (MOI) that stays stable even on off-center strikes.

Whether you are a scratch player looking for more feedback or a high-handicapper who prefers a traditional look, the EF Legacy provides the consistency you need to lower your scores.
